Value of Microsoft Accessibility in Your Organization
Mid to big companies may have hundreds to thousands of computer. Each desktop has typical software program that allows staff to achieve computing jobs without the intervention of the organization's IT division. This uses the primary tenet of desktop computer computer: encouraging customers to raise performance as well as reduced costs with decentralized computer.
As the globe's most preferred desktop data source, Microsoft Gain access to is used in mostly all organizations that utilize Microsoft Windows. As customers become much more proficient in the operation of these applications, they begin to identify options to service jobs that they themselves could carry out. The all-natural advancement of this procedure is that spread sheets and databases are produced and also preserved by end-users to manage their day-to-day jobs.
This dynamic permits both efficiency as well as agility as customers are empowered to solve organisation issues without the intervention of their organization's Information Technology facilities. Microsoft Access suits this space by providing a desktop computer database setting where end-users could quickly establish database applications with tables, inquiries, types and reports. Gain access to is suitable for inexpensive single customer or workgroup database applications.
But this power has a rate. As more customers use Microsoft Accessibility to manage their work, issues of data safety, reliability, maintainability, scalability and management come to be severe. The people who built these solutions are seldom educated to be database professionals, developers or system managers. As databases outgrow the abilities of the initial writer, they have to relocate into an extra robust setting.
While some people consider this a reason why end-users shouldn't ever before use Microsoft Gain access to, we consider this to be the exception instead of the rule. A lot of Microsoft Access data sources are produced by end-users and also never ever should finish to the following level. Implementing an approach to develop every end-user data source "expertly" would be a substantial waste of sources.
For the uncommon Microsoft Gain access to databases that are so effective that they have to evolve, SQL Server provides the following all-natural development. Without shedding the existing investment in the application (table styles, data, inquiries, forms, records, macros and components), information can be relocated to SQL Server as well as the Access database connected to it. Once in SQL Server, various other systems such as Visual Studio.NET can be utilized to produce Windows, internet and/or mobile remedies. The Access database application could be completely replaced or a hybrid remedy may be created.
For additional information, read our paper Microsoft Gain access to within a Company's General Data source Method.
Microsoft Gain Access To as well as SQL Database Architectures
Microsoft Gain access to is the premier desktop computer database product available for Microsoft Windows. Because its intro in 1992, Accessibility has provided a flexible system for novices and power users to develop single-user as well as small workgroup database applications.
Microsoft Accessibility has actually taken pleasure in wonderful success due to the fact that it pioneered the idea of tipping customers with a difficult task with the use of Wizards. This, in addition to an instinctive inquiry designer, among the very best desktop coverage tools and the incorporation of macros as well as a coding setting, all add to making Access the most effective selection for desktop computer database advancement.
Because Accessibility is created to be easy to use and friendly, it was never meant as a platform for the most reputable as well as robust applications. As a whole, upsizing must occur when these qualities become important for the application. Thankfully, the versatility of Gain access to allows you to upsize to SQL Server in a range of ways, from a fast cost-effective, data-moving situation to full application redesign.
Gain access to provides a rich variety of information architectures that enable it to take care of data in a range of methods. When thinking about an upsizing project, it is very important to recognize the variety of methods Accessibility could be set up to use its native Jet database format and also SQL Server in both solitary as well as multi-user settings.
Gain access to as well as the Jet Engine
Microsoft Access has its very own data source engine-- the Microsoft Jet Database Engine (additionally called the ACE with Access 2007's introduction of the ACCDB style). Jet was developed from the beginning to support solitary individual and multiuser documents sharing on a lan. Databases have an optimum size of 2 GB, although an Access database can attach to other data sources by means of connected tables and also several backend data sources to workaround the 2 GB limitation.
Yet Access is greater than a data source engine. It is likewise an application growth atmosphere that permits customers to develop queries, develop forms and also records, and compose macros as well as Aesthetic Fundamental for Applications (VBA) component code to automate an application. In its default configuration, Gain access to makes use of Jet inside to keep its layout items such as forms, reports, macros, and components and also utilizes Jet to store all table information.
One of the primary advantages of Gain access to upsizing is that you can upgrade your application to remain to use its kinds, reports, macros as well as modules, and also replace the Jet Engine with SQL Server. This allows the most effective of both globes: the ease of use of Accessibility with the dependability and security of SQL Server.
Prior to you try to convert an Access database to SQL Server, make sure you recognize:
Which applications belong in Microsoft Gain access to vs. SQL Server? Not every data source ought to be changed.
The reasons for upsizing your data source. Ensure SQL Server gives you exactly what you look for.
The tradeoffs for doing so. There are ands also as well as minuses relying on exactly what you're aiming to optimize. Make certain you are not moving to SQL Server entirely for efficiency reasons.
In many cases, efficiency lowers when an application is upsized, particularly for reasonably small databases (under 200 MEGABYTES).
Some efficiency issues are unassociated to the backend database. Inadequately made questions as well as table style won't be repaired by upsizing. Microsoft Accessibility tables offer some functions that SQL Server tables do not such as an automated refresh when the information adjustments. SQL Server requires an explicit requery.
Choices for Moving Microsoft Accessibility to SQL Server
There are numerous options for hosting SQL Server databases:
A regional instance of SQL Express, which is a cost-free variation of SQL Server can be installed on each user's device
A shared SQL Server database on your network
A cloud host such as SQL Azure. Cloud hosts have safety that restriction which IP addresses could retrieve data, so fixed IP addresses and/or VPN is necessary.
There are numerous ways to upsize your Microsoft Access databases to SQL Server:
Move the data to SQL Server and link to it from your Access database while preserving the existing Access application.
Adjustments may be should sustain SQL Server questions and also distinctions from Gain access to databases.
Convert an Access MDB database to an Accessibility Information Job (ADP) that attaches directly to a SQL Server database.
Because ADPs were deprecated in Access 2013, we do not advise this option.
Usage Microsoft Accessibility with MS Azure.
With Office365, your data is published into a SQL Server database organized by SQL Azure with an Accessibility Internet front end
Suitable for basic viewing and editing and enhancing of data throughout the internet
However, Accessibility Web Apps do not have the customization showcases equivalent to VBA in Accessibility desktop remedies
Move the whole application to the.NET Structure, ASP.NET, and SQL Server platform, or recreate it on SharePoint.
A crossbreed option that puts the data in SQL Server with another front-end plus an Access front-end data source.
SQL Server can be the standard variation organized on a business high quality web server or a totally free SQL Server Express version installed on your PC
Data source Challenges in a Company
Every company has to get rid of data source challenges to accomplish their mission. These obstacles consist of:
• Optimizing return on investment
• Handling personnels
• Rapid deployment
• Flexibility and also maintainability
• Scalability (additional).
Taking Full Advantage Of Roi.
Taking full advantage of roi is extra crucial than ever before. Monitoring requires tangible results for the expensive investments in data source application development. Numerous database advancement efforts cannot produce the outcomes they promise. Choosing the best innovation as well as technique for each and every degree in a company is essential to maximizing return on investment. This means selecting the very best overall return, which doesn't imply picking the least pricey first service. This is often one of the most crucial choice a chief info policeman (CIO) or chief additional resources technology police officer (CTO) makes.
Taking Care Of Human Resources.
Handling people to customize modern technology is testing. The more complex the modern technology or application, the less individuals are qualified to handle it, and also the more pricey they are to work with. Turnover is constantly the original source a problem, and having the right criteria is critical to successfully supporting tradition applications. Training and staying up to date with technology are additionally challenging.
Producing data source applications swiftly is essential, not just for minimizing costs, but also for reacting to inner or client needs. The capacity to produce applications quickly offers a considerable competitive advantage.
The IT manager is accountable for offering alternatives and making tradeoffs to sustain the business requirements of the organization. By utilizing various innovations, you could use company choice makers choices, such as a 60 percent option in three months, a 90 percent option in twelve months, or a 99 percent remedy in twenty-four months. (Instead of months, maybe dollars.) Sometimes, time to market is most vital, various other times it could be expense, and also other times attributes or security are most important. Needs alter swiftly as well as are uncertain. We stay in a "adequate" rather than an ideal world, so understanding the best ways to supply "adequate" remedies quickly gives you and your organization a competitive edge.
Flexibility and Maintainability.
Even with the most effective system design, by the time multiple month advancement initiatives are completed, needs modification. Variations adhere to variations, as well as a system that's made to be adaptable as well as able to suit modification could suggest the distinction between success and also failure for the individuals' careers.
Solution ought to be designed to handle the expected information and even more. Yet several informative post systems are never completed, are disposed of quickly, or change so much over time that the first evaluations are wrong. Scalability is necessary, but usually less important compared to a fast service. If the application efficiently sustains development, scalability can be added later on when it's economically justified.